About the Role

The Brand Marketing team brings the Stitch Fix brand to life through cohesive, relevant storytelling across the client experience. As a Senior Associate, Integrated Marketing, you'll help shape and manage our integrated marketing calendar, connecting priorities across Merchandising, Channel Marketing, PR, Styling, and Creative teams. You'll play a key role in ensuring our marketing moments are coordinated, timely, culturally relevant, and consistently executed across channels, while supporting content, site and app refreshes, brand partnerships, and the Stitch Fix blog.

Responsibilities:
  • Build and manage the integrated marketing calendar, developing key marketing moments and driving cross-functional alignment across Merchandising, CRM, Social, PR, Growth, Styling, and Creative partners.
  • Coordinate and review content and creative workstreams across paid social, site, app, blog, and other channels to ensure execution aligns with integrated marketing priorities, merchandising strategies, and brand standards.
  • Own the Stitch Fix blog strategy from planning through publishing, partnering with Creative, Copy, Merchandising, and SEO teams to deliver fresh, relevant content.
  • Identify and activate culturally relevant trends, seasonal moments, and brand storytelling opportunities, partnering with channel owners and Creative to bring ideas to life in fresh and effective ways.
  • Support and coordinate site and app creative refreshes, brand partnerships, and external brand or vendor logistics, ensuring projects stay organized, on schedule, and aligned with broader marketing priorities.

About Stitch Fix, Inc

Stitch Fix is an online personal styling service that uses data and technology to provide personalized clothing recommendations to its customers. The company was founded in 2011 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California. Stitch Fix's business model is based on a subscription service, where customers pay a monthly fee to receive a box of clothing items selected by a personal stylist. The company has been successful in leveraging data and technology to provide a personalized and convenient shopping experience for its customers. Stitch Fix went public in 2017 and is traded on the NASDAQ stock exchange under the ticker symbol SFIX.
